Melanotan I (also known as afamelanotide) acts on MC1R and has increased resistance to enzymatic breakdown, whereas melanotan II is a shorter cyclic variant that increases pigmentation at a lower cumulative dose and is less specific and more lipophilic, thereby crossing the blood-brain barrier more easily, leading to more widespread adverse effects
